The Senior Attorney will manage and lead an active caseload of state and federal plaintiff's-side wage-and-hour, class, and representative action litigation against regional, national, and Fortune 500 companies, while also providing guidance and oversight to associate attorneys.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to, developing case strategy; conducting and responding to complex discovery; taking and defending depositions; drafting and arguing dispositive and class certification motions; leading settlement negotiations; appearing in court for hearings and trial; and mentoring junior attorneys on litigation best practices. Our agenda is growing and the ideal candidate for this position is a licensed, highly experienced litigator with a strong track record in complex or class action litigation who is organized, professional, and committed to achieving strong outcomes for our clients.
